Add Energy to Your Scrapbook Pages with Complementary Color Scheme
A complementary color scheme uses colors opposite one another on the color wheel, for example red and green or blue and orange. This is the highest contrast color scheme. Use it with fully saturated colors, and you've got a strong, vibrant look. If you don't want an...
